Toshiba’s REGZA Z870/875 Series 4K UHD TVs Will Please Gamers

Toshiba’s REGZA Z870/875 series 4K UHD TVs for 2023 provide support for both movie viewing and gaming. But will they be made available in the U.S.?

Toshiba Regza Z875L Mini LED 4K TV Front

Toshiba has announced the Regza Z870/875 Series MiniLED 4K UHD TV line. It is still unclear if this TV line will become available in the U.S. as the current TV lineup does not include Toshiba’s Z-series models, but we are working to get confirmation from Toshiba.  

Here is a look at what Toshiba is promoting. 

Tip: Hisense currently owns Toshiba’s TV Business

Core Features

Image Display: The Z870/875 LCD TVs incorporate Mini LED backlighting combined with Quantum Dots. This combination allows for improved local dimming for a more precise display of blacks and whites, and the Quantum Dots support better color. Additional video processing support is provided by the latest version of the REGZA processor.  

Regza Mini LED Diagram

Gaming: The Z870/875 series is also capable of 120Hz or 144Hz refresh rate (may vary by model) and MEMC motion processing, making them ideal for gaming. Further gaming support is provided by Toshiba’s Game Mode Pro, which includes ALLM (Auto Low Latency Mode), VRR (Variable Refresh Rate), and AMD FreeSync technology

Color and HDR: The Toshiba REGZA engine supports 97% of the DCI-P3 color gamut. The Z870/875 series is compatible with the Dolby Vision HDR format

Audio: On the audio side, the TV has a built-in 2.1 channel sound system, as well as Dolby Atmos support. You can also connect the TV to an external sound system via digital optical audio output or HDMI-ARC/eARC

Wired Connectivity: Other connectivity options include HDMI 2.1, HDMI 2.0, and USB 2.0. 

Smart TV: In keeping with “modern” TVs, the Z870/875 series are also smart TVs with Wi-Fi built-in, but the exact Smart OS and app selection may vary depending on the regional market so no details have been mentioned so far. Screen mirroring capability is included.  

Regza 75Z875L Mini LED 4K TV

Screen Sizes: A 100-inch model is already available in China. The 100-inch model includes 256 local dimming zones and up to 1,400 nits of light output. Additional sizes announced so far are 75 inches (75Z875L), 65 inches (65Z875L), and 55 inches (55Z870L).

Tip: It’s important to note that the global version of these TVs has built-in video recording capability, but that feature is not included in some markets, such as the United States.

Price and Availability

The 100-inch Toshiba Z870 TV retails in China for 34,999 yuan (~$5,080 USD). It is expected that several screen size options will become available in several global markets by mid-2023 (July), whether any models will become available in the US remains to be seen.
